An airline owns an aging fleet of Boeing 737 jet airplanes. Itis considering a major purchase of up to 17 new Boeing model 787and 767 jets. The decision must take into account numerous cost andcapability factors, including the following: (1) the airline canfinance up to $1.6 billion in purchases; (2) each Boeing 787 willcost $80 million, and each Boeing 767 will cost $110 million; (3)at least one-third of the planes purchased should be thelonger-range 787; (4) the annual maintenance budget is to be nomore than $8 million; (5) the annual maintenance cost per 787 isestimated to be $800,000, and it is $500,000 for each 767purchased; and (6) each 787 can carry 125,000 passengers per year,whereas each 767 can fly 81,000 passengers annually. Formulate thisas an integer programming problem to maximize the annualpassenger-carrying capability. What category of integer programmingproblem is this? Solve this problem.
